break、continue、return在循环中用法的区别

简介: break、continue、return在循环中用法的区别

1. break :

(1).结束当前整个循环,执行当前循环下边的语句。忽略循环体中任何其它语句和循环条件测试。

(2).只能跳出一层循环,如果你的循环是嵌套循环,那么你需要按照你嵌套的层次,逐步使用break来跳出。

2. continue:

(1).终止本次循环的执行,即跳过当前这次循环中continue语句后尚未执行的语句,接着进行下一次循环条件的判断。

(2).结束当前循环,进行下一次的循环判断。

(3).终止当前的循环过程,但他并不跳出循环,而是继续往下判断循环条件执行语句.他只能结束循环中的一次过程,但不能终止循环继续进行.

3. return:

(1).return 从当前的方法中退出,返回到该调用的方法的语句处,继续执行。

(2).return 返回一个值给调用该方法的语句,返回值的数据类型必须与方法的声明中的返回值的类型一致。

(3). return后面也可以不带参数,不带参数就是返回空,其实主要目的就是用于想中断函数执行,返回调用函数

相关文章
|
5天前
|
存储 编译器 C++
C++ Break、Continue 和 数组操作详解
C++中的`break`语句用于跳出循环,例如在`for`或`while`循环中。`continue`则跳过当前迭代的剩余部分。数组用于存储多个相同类型值,声明时指定类型和元素数量。访问和修改数组元素通过索引操作,索引从0开始。遍历数组可使用常规`for`循环或C++11引入的`foreach`循环。可以省略数组大小声明,编译器会根据初始值自动计算,但明确指定更佳。
33 0
|
5天前
|
C#
c#一文读懂continue、return、break区别
c#一文读懂continue、return、break区别
10 0
|
5天前
|
存储 数据可视化 C#
C# Break 和 Continue 语句以及数组详解
它被用于“跳出” switch 语句。 break 语句也可用于跳出循环。 以下示例在 i 等于 4 时跳出循环: 示例:
60 0
|
5天前
|
存储 C语言 索引
深入解析 C 语言中的 for 循环、break 和 continue
当您确切地知道要循环执行代码块的次数时,可以使用 for 循环而不是 while 循环
186 0
|
8月前
|
Java
关键字break和return的区别
关键字break和return的区别
51 0
|
11月前
continue和break的区别
continue和break的区别
80 0
|
Java
java三种循环(for、while、do while)和终止语句(break、continue、return)
for循环一般在明确循环条件和循环次数时使用。(常用) while(while先判断再执行,不通过则不执行)循环和do...while(至少先执行一次后再进行判断)循环在不明确循环次数时使用。
242 0
写出continue和break的区别
写出continue和break的区别
87 0